Q: Is 616,253,463 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 616,253,463 is a composite number.

Why is 616,253,463 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 616,253,463 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 21 37 63 111 259 333 463 571 777 1,389 1,713 2,331 3,241 3,997 4,167 5,139 9,723 11,991 17,131 21,127 29,169 35,973 51,393 63,381 119,917 147,889 154,179 190,143 264,373 359,751 443,667 793,119 1,079,253 1,331,001 1,850,611 2,379,357 5,551,833 9,781,801 16,655,499 29,345,403 68,472,607 88,036,209 205,417,821 and 616,253,463, with no remainder.

Since 616,253,463 cannot be divided by just 1 and 616,253,463, it is a composite number.
